Internal memo — Finance Team

Subject: Regional sales review, Q2

The review of Tresmont Goods' four regions is complete. Northvale exceeded target by 6%; Darrow Plain lagged on churn in the Opaline line. Variance analyses and corrected accruals are filed in the quarterly workbook. Please reconcile rebate provisions before close. The confidential note on forward plans that informed this review is set out below.

board note of bahaf-kahif: Gross margin on Wenael came in at 10 percent against a plan of 15 percent. Only 7 of the 120 pilot accounts renewed Wenael, so a churn review is set for July 1.

**Mgmt Meeting Minutes — Retiring the Brightline Range**

Quick recap for sales leads at Fenholt Supplies: we agreed to retire the Brightline fixture range by year-end. Remaining stock moves to clearance pricing next month, and accounts on standing orders get migrated to the Lumetta range. Trade-in incentives were approved in principle. The confidential note on next steps sits just below.

board note of bajof-bajeg: The pricing group signed off on a budget of $13.4 million for Project Sildor. The renewal with Lamixek Holdings closes at $48.9 million a year, 49 percent above the last contract.

**Build Provenance: The Stale-Cache Incident**

Quick context for support folks fielding tickets about the Lumenary dashboard showing old data last Tuesday. Our build cache on the Farrow CI cluster served a week-old artifact because the cache key didn't include the config hash. Fix is merged; tell customers a refresh after today resolves it. If anyone asks which build fixed it, reference the token below.

build token for tafop-haduf: htk31_7289156dd3fe39a42066f8714f71d27

## Quiet Room — Level 6

The quiet room on the top floor of Pellbrook Tower is meant for focused work and short breaks, not meetings — please point people elsewhere if they try to book it. Facilities handles the plants, the lamp timers, and the weekly tidy. Capacity is six; no calls, no food. The door locks outside 08:00–18:00, and the after-hours keypad takes the staff code listed below.

turnstile pass: bdg-PD-2